Wolves fans react as Spurs reportedly eye Nuno Espirito Santo
A number of Wolves fans have taken to Twitter to comment on reports from the Daily Express claiming that Spurs are interested in Nuno Espirito Santo.
Jose Mourinho is coming under increasing pressure in North London. Tottenham have experienced a sharp decline since going top of the Premier League earlier in the season.

It remains to be seen what the future holds for Mourinho. Spurs are not out of the running to finish in the top four. And they could yet win silverware with the Carabao Cup final ahead.

The Daily Express reports that if a change is made in the summer, Nuno is one of the managers on Daniel Levy’s radar.
(Photo by Sam Bagnall – AMA/Getty Images)
The report suggests that Wolves would want £8 million in compensation should Tottenham come calling. But judging by the reaction, it appears that some Wolves fans would not be too disappointed if he was lured away from Molineux.
Some seemingly think that they need a new manager to move on to the next level. And they are baffled at the idea of appointing Nuno as Mourinho’s successor if Tottenham have any desire to change their style of play.
